How to communicate research with a lay audience

Why should I share information about my research?

Scientific funding comes mostly from government agencies or charitable organisations. In both of these sectors, communication with people who do not have a scientific background is key to securing funding. Alongside the ability to secure grants, communicating your research with the public, who are directly affected by the work you are doing, means science is less of a mystery. If and when research reaches the clinical trial stages, people better understand the work that has been put in and are less apprehensive about getting involved. People who donate to charities are also more likely to give when they have a clear understanding of what their money is going to and the specific impact of the work being done. This opens the door to more funding towards further research for a project you may be a part of.

How should I communicate?

There are a number of ways to present your research to a lay audience. You could write a blog, film an interview or create a short presentation. The format is only the first step to giving people a chance to understand the research happening in your laboratory. The key things are to be engaging and clear.

When applying for grants you often have to produce a lay summary, as the grant may be assessed for funding by people who have little or no understanding of the science you are creating. It is important to write it in a way that explains it to someone who has no understanding of the subject.

Some tips

Know your target audience

The average reading level in the UK is that of a 9 to 11 year old. When explaining science, this fact must be taken into consideration. For a resource going out to the general public, common terms and analyses in the scientific world require clearer explanation with as little jargon as possible. This might be explaining the purpose of specific machines such as PCR, or assays like a western blot. This explanation should be clearly written and easily readable.

Have graphics

A block of text or video without any images can be overwhelming to focus on. Using images gives an alternative method to understand the written concept and also breaks up text nicely. Images are particularly helpful for understanding common assay and analysis procedures.

Use analogies

Comparing complex scientific principles using objects and interactions seen in everyday life helps people to understand and visualise concepts in a new way, boosting their understanding. Some examples may be describing DNA as building blocks that make an instruction manual for a cell, or comparing cell-to-cell signalling to neighbours calling messages to each other from a window. There are many creative ways that science can be explained.

Practice

Invite people to visit your laboratory to practise using terminology and explaining the work you are doing. This way you can see their body language and facial expressions to gauge the understanding that the visitors have. If they look confused, you may need to change some of your language to work with people of all ages and knowledge levels.
